Social Media Content Calendar
As for my marketing role, I am given the responsibility of ensuring that Edelman’s social media platforms such as Facebook, Twitter and the intern blog are updated daily. With this task, I learnt how to create a social media content calendar. I understand the significance of why we have to prepare for a content calendar and here are a few points to share.
1. It can help us to motivate our audience and what interest them so as to make a connection to our brand.
2. It made the flow of content on social media platforms consistent so that we can maximize engagement.
3. It can highlight any gaps therefore, we could plan ahead of time to think of ideas to publish.
4. It can map time-sensitive content ahead of time and allows flexibility to any real-time activities to slip in.
My daily tasks involve exploring multiple global Edelman channels for interesting announcements, insights, blog posts or news concerning the PR & marketing industry. I also look through multiple Twitter accounts to stay up to date among Edelman offices around the globe – constantly updating the calendar content for the latest news/activities.
With this research, I prepare a weekly calendar of which I have to update daily in case new content arises. From the content calendar, I have to prepare a caption for what we publish and always keeping it in mind that we must understand our stakeholders and connect the content to them and their interests.
